Provider Score in 01531, New Braintree, Massachusetts

The Provider Score for the Prostate Cancer Score in 01531, New Braintree, Massachusetts is 94 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 95.53 percent of the residents in 01531 has some form of health insurance. 41.83 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 71.29 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ase. Military veterans should know that percent of the residents in the ZIP Code of 01531 have VA health insurance. Also, percent of the residents receive TRICARE.

For the 209 residents under the age of 18, there is an estimate of 0 pediatricians in a 20-mile radius of 01531. An estimate of 0 geriatricians or physicians who focus on the elderly who can serve the 234 residents over the age of 65 years.

In a 20-mile radius, there are 769 health care providers accessible to residents in 01531, New Braintree, Massachusetts.

Within ZIP code 01531, a detailed assessment of prostate cancer care begins with understanding the concentration of urologists and primary care physicians. The physician-to-patient ratio is a crucial indicator. A higher ratio of physicians to patients generally suggests greater accessibility to care. However, this ratio alone does not fully represent the quality of care. The qualifications, experience, and specialization of the physicians are equally important. Are there board-certified urologists? Are they affiliated with reputable hospitals or cancer centers? These factors influence the quality of care a patient receives.

Analyzing primary care availability in New Braintree is equally critical. Primary care physicians often serve as the initial point of contact for patients experiencing symptoms or concerns about prostate health. Timely access to primary care is essential for early detection and prompt referral to specialists. The availability of primary care physicians, including family medicine practitioners and internal medicine specialists, must be considered. The geographic distribution of these physicians within New Braintree and the surrounding areas impacts accessibility.

Standout practices, those that demonstrate excellence in prostate cancer care, are evaluated based on several criteria. These include the use of advanced diagnostic tools, such as MRI and prostate-specific antigen (PSA) testing, the availability of minimally invasive surgical techniques, and the integration of multidisciplinary care teams. A multidisciplinary approach, involving urologists, oncologists, radiation oncologists, and other specialists, ensures a comprehensive and coordinated approach to treatment. Practices that actively participate in clinical trials and research initiatives are also noteworthy, as they often provide access to cutting-edge treatments.

Telemedicine adoption is another critical aspect of modern healthcare. The ability to conduct virtual consultations, remotely monitor patients, and provide education and support through digital platforms can significantly improve access to care, especially for patients in rural or underserved areas. Practices that have embraced telemedicine technologies are often better positioned to provide convenient and timely care. The availability of virtual appointments, remote monitoring capabilities, and patient portals are all indicators of a practice's commitment to telemedicine.

Mental health resources are often overlooked, but they are a vital component of comprehensive cancer care. A prostate cancer diagnosis can be emotionally challenging for patients and their families. The availability of mental health support services, such as counseling, support groups, and psychiatric care, can significantly impact a patient's well-being and their ability to cope with the disease. Practices that integrate mental health services into their care model are demonstrating a commitment to holistic patient care.
